摘要
A numerical method is proposed for the efficient solution of shape optimization problems, which combines the boundary perturbation technique and finite element analysis. The method is computationally efficient in that it requires a number of finite element analyses with a fixed geometry, as opposed to standard shape optimization which requires re-analysis with varying geometry. The application of the method to general shape optimization is considered. In addition, a special optimization scheme is devised for a class of problems governed by linear partial differential equations. The performance of the method is illustrated via an example which involves acoustic wave scattering from an obstacle. Copyright (C) 2000 John Wiley & Sons, Ltd.
